October has been a very busy month for the Ukulele group.
On Sunday 6 October a group of members travelled to Melbourne to take part in the Ukulele Extravaganza held at the Federation Square as part of Seniors Week. All players sang two songs “The Real Thing” by Russell Morris and “Happy Together”.

A week later a group of the Benalla U3A members attended the annual Whittlesea Muster. The format of day included the opportunity to take part in a series of Workshops as well as jamming sessions. A very informative day with the opportunity of networking with other groups.
The group was also invited to play at the recent Get On-line Week Luncheon which was most successful.
On the Wednesday 23rd October the group was asked to play at the ‘World Flavours Morning Tea’ which was held at the Town Hall.

The group is now practising the songs that will be played at the end of year musical concert at the Meet and Mingle session on Wednesday 20th November.
